How much do shop foreman j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for shop foreman in Oregon is $69,009.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,900.00 and $84,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a shop foreman?

A Shop Foreman is a supervisory position in manufacturing, automotive, or repair shops responsible for overseeing daily operations and managing a team of technicians or workers. They ensure that work is completed efficiently, safely, and according to quality standards. Shop Foremen also coordinate workflow, assign tasks, resolve issues on the shop floor, and often serve as a liaison between management and employees. Their role is crucial for maintaining productivity, safety, and organization within the shop environ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a shop foreman?

To excel as a Shop Foreman, you need extensive knowledge of mechanical systems, supervisory experience, and often a relevant technical certification or apprenticeship. Familiarity with maintenance management software, diagnostic tools, and safety regulations is typically required.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help a Shop Foreman effectively manage teams and resolve workflow issues. These competencies are essential to ensure operational efficiency, safety, and high-quality work output in a busy shop environment.

What are some common challenges a shop foreman faces when managing a team of technicians?

Shop Foremen often encounter challenges such as balancing workload distribution, ensuring team members adhere to safety and quality standards, and managing varying skill levels among technicians. Effective communication is crucial, as the Shop Foreman must relay information between management and the shop floor while also resolving conflicts and scheduling issues. Building a cohesive team and maintaining high morale are ongoing responsibilities that require strong leadership and organizational skills.

What is the difference between Shop Foreman vs Service Manager?

AspectShop ForemanService Manager
CredentialsRelevant certifications, experience in shop operationsOften requires certifications and managerial experience
Work EnvironmentHands-on shop floor, overseeing techniciansOffice and customer interaction, overseeing service department
Employer & Industry UsageAutomotive, construction, manufacturing industriesAutomotive, heavy equipment, industrial sectors

The Shop Foreman primarily manages daily shop operations and technicians, focusing on technical tasks and workflow. The Service Manager oversees the entire service department, including customer relations and administrative duties. While both roles require industry experience, the Shop Foreman is more hands-on, whereas the Service Manager has broader managerial responsibilities.
